Gypsum is usually a soft sulfate mineral made up of calcium sulfate dihydrate, Together with the chemical method CaSO4·2H2O. It really is extensively located in character and has actually been utilized by humans for Countless several years. Gypsum is a standard mineral that is certainly found in sedimentary rock formations and is commonly connected to other minerals including halite, anhydrite, and sulfur. It is a flexible mineral which has an array of utilizes in many industries, like agriculture, construction, and production.

Gypsum is really a The natural way taking place mineral that is shaped in the evaporation of seawater. It is usually present in large deposits in regions where there was after a shallow sea, including the Mediterranean Sea and the Great Salt Lake in Utah. Gypsum can be located in volcanic rock formations and in places where by there has been a substantial focus of sulfur in the soil. The mineral is typically white or colorless, nonetheless it can also seem in shades of gray, brown, or pink, depending upon the impurities present inside the rock. Gypsum incorporates a Mohs hardness of two, which implies it is relatively gentle and can be very easily scratched by using a fingernail.

The Works by using of Gypsum


Gypsum has a variety of uses in various industries because of its distinctive Qualities. The most widespread employs of gypsum is inside the production of plaster and drywall. When gypsum is heated to close to 150°C, it loses its water content and results in being a great powder often known as plaster of Paris. This powder is often combined with water to form a paste which might be accustomed to make molds, casts, and sculptures. Plaster of Paris is additionally used to make drywall, which is a well-liked constructing materials for inside partitions and ceilings.

As well as its use in construction, gypsum is likewise Utilized in agriculture as a soil Modification. Gypsum will help improve soil framework and drainage, minimize soil compaction, and increase The supply of nutrients to plants. It might also assist to neutralize soil acidity and Increase the efficiency of fertilizers. Gypsum is usually used in the creation of cement and as being a filler in paper, paint, and plastics. It is usually employed to be a desiccant to absorb humidity and as a coagulant from the production of tofu.

The Benefits of Gypsum in Agriculture


Gypsum has prolonged been regarded for its helpful outcomes on soil and crop production. One of several main benefits of employing gypsum in agriculture is its power to enhance soil construction. Gypsum can help to interrupt up compacted soil and improve drainage, which may lead to much better root advancement and increased water infiltration. This may end up in more healthy plants with enhanced resistance to drought and ailment.

Another benefit of employing gypsum in agriculture is its capacity to cut down soil erosion. Gypsum may also help to stabilize soil particles and forestall them from being washed away by rain or irrigation. This could assist to guard beneficial topsoil and prevent nutrient reduction, which may lead to enhanced crop yields. Gypsum could also help to decrease the hazardous consequences of soil salinity by displacing sodium ions within the soil particles and bettering the availability of other necessary nutrients.

Gypsum could also support to improve the performance of fertilizers by rising the availability of nutrients to vegetation. Gypsum can assist to reduce nutrient leaching and runoff, which may lead to improved nutrient uptake by vegetation. This may result in healthier vegetation with higher yields and improved excellent. In addition, gypsum may help to neutralize soil acidity and Increase the pH balance of the soil, which may lead to improved nutrient availability and better plant expansion.

The Function of Gypsum in Construction


Gypsum performs a crucial part in the construction sector as a consequence of its distinctive Attributes and versatility. One of several most important takes advantage of of gypsum in building is within the production of plaster and drywall. Plaster of Paris, which happens to be made from gypsum, is utilised to build molds, casts, and sculptures for decorative uses. It is also accustomed to make drywall, which is a well-liked setting up material for interior walls and ceilings.

Drywall is constructed from gypsum which has been compressed in between two levels of paper to sort rigid panels. These panels are light-weight, straightforward to setup, and provide excellent fire resistance and audio insulation. Drywall is a price-productive making substance that may be greatly Employed in residential and industrial development jobs. It might be effortlessly completed with paint or wallpaper to create a smooth, appealing surface.

How Gypsum is Formed


Gypsum is shaped with the evaporation of seawater over a lot of a long time. When seawater evaporates, it leaves behind dissolved minerals for instance calcium sulfate, which may crystallize into gypsum underneath the proper conditions. Gypsum can even be formed from the evaporation of saline lakes or from the response of sulfuric acid with limestone or dolomite.
